PRINCIPAL DISPLAY PANEL – Docetaxel Injection, USP, 80 mg per 4 mL Vial Label - doc08 0000 14 v4

This is a description of a medication called Docetaxel, which is an injection containing 80 mg per 4 mL (20 mg per mL) for intravenous use only. It is a cytotoxic agent and should be added to an infusion solution. The medication is stored between 2° and 25°C, protected from light. The manufacturer is Meitheal Pharmaceuticals based in Chicago, IL, USA. A caution is given to discard any unused portion of the 4 mL single-dose vial.*
